ISSP Continues Operations in Face of COVID-19 Epidemic

Dear Customers and Partners,

In the face of the COVID-19 epidemic, we want to assure you that the ISSP team continues to operate in accordance with our emergency action plan and maintains the highest level of protection and security of your company's information networks and systems.

Despite the likelihood of increasing number of cyberattacks (APT and phishing attacks), all ISSP services are fully operational, and we continue to provide you with the highest quality services.

ISSP has been developing Managed Security Services since 2015, and we are fully prepared to work in extreme situations, and provide cybersecurity consulting, technical support, cybersecurity monitoring and incident detection and response services.

Starting from March 13, 2020, ISSP has implemented a business continuity plan and taken every precaution to protect the health of our employees. At present, most ISSP employees work remotely to maintain the quality of all the company functions and services. ISSP has taken all the necessary measures to protect remote work technologies, company information assets, and our customers' information, namely:

  • Remote work of the key company specialists in order to minimize simultaneous infection of the critical mass of employees.

  • Remote access is arranged through encrypted access channel, with the use of enhanced multi-factor authentication, and monitoring of all activities by our own Security Operations Center.

  • End-users are provided with corporate laptops with information encryption functionality and state-of-the-art preventive cyber-security protection and threats monitoring tools.
